The OPA627AU/2K5G4 is a high-precision operational amplifier (op-amp) from Texas Instruments, designed to cater to a wide array of applications that require high-speed and low-noise performance. This op-amp is well-suited for professional audio equipment, test and measurement instruments, and high-end consumer electronics.
Key Features
- High-Speed Performance: The OPA627AU/2K5G4 boasts a fast slew rate and wide bandwidth, which are essential for applications that require rapid signal processing without sacrificing accuracy.
- Low Noise: With its low-noise characteristics, this op-amp ensures a clean and precise signal amplification, making it ideal for sensitive audio and instrumentation applications.
- High Open-Loop Gain: The device provides a high level of gain without feedback, which is beneficial when designing circuits that require precise control over gain settings.
- Dual-Supply Operation: It can operate from a dual supply voltage, providing flexibility in designing both bipolar and single-supply circuits.
- Robust Design: The OPA627AU/2K5G4 is built to be durable and reliable, ensuring stable performance over a wide range of operating conditions.

Ordering Information
The OPA627AU/2K5G4 is available in a 2.5k reel, providing an efficient solution for mass production requirements. The G4 suffix indicates the level of compliance with green standards, ensuring that the product meets environmental regulations for electronics.
